The **Townsville Sub Branch Vietnam Veterans Association of Australia Inc.** (ABN 93094665213RR0001) represents a regional chapter of the Vietnam Veterans Association of Australia (VVAA), dedicated to supporting veterans and their families. Established as part of a broader national movement, the sub-branch focuses on advocacy and welfare services for those affected by service in conflicts, particularly addressing health concerns linked to wartime exposures.

### History and Purpose  
The VVAA originated in the late 1970s as the **Vietnam Veterans Action Association**, formed in response to mounting health issues among veterans attributed to Agent Orange and other chemical exposures during the Vietnam War. These exposures were linked to conditions ranging from cancers to psychological trauma, including post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). The Townsville sub-branch emerged to address localized needs, operating independently of traditional veterans' organizations like the RSL, which many felt inadequately represented their postwar challenges.

### Activities and Advocacy  
The sub-branch provides claims assistance, welfare support, and camaraderie for veterans of conflicts such as Vietnam, later wars, and peacekeeping operations. Historically, it has advocated for recognition of chemical exposure effects, countering government inaction highlighted by the contentious 1983 Evatt Royal Commission findings. Its motto, reflecting a commitment to honoring both fallen and surviving veterans, underscores ongoing efforts to secure equitable treatment for service-related health conditions.

### Organizational Structure  
As a nonprofit, the sub-branch operates under the national VVAA framework, which includes state/territory offices and regional sub-branches across Australia. The Townsville group collaborates with entities like Veterans Support Centre NQ Inc. while maintaining autonomy in delivering localized services. Membership is open to eligible veterans, fostering a community-oriented approach to advocacy and mutual aid.

Home Welcome to the homepage of the Townsville SubBranch of the Vietnam Veterans Association of Australia We are the most Northern Branch of the VVAA in Queensland situated in the tropical north at Townsville City. We cover an area from The Cape down to Rockhampton and from Townsville out west to Mt Isa. The aim of the SubBranch is to assist Vietnam Veterans and Veterans of other conflicts and operations with any claims that they may have through our Welfare Pension Officers and Advocates. It does not matter where you served we are all part of the Veteran Family.
